How does the position of an element in the periodic table relate to its properties?
The position of an element in the periodic table is crucial in determining its properties. Elements in the same group have similar chemical properties due to the same number of valence electrons, while elements in the same period have the same number of electron shells, impacting their atomic size and reactivity. Additionally, the position of an element can also reveal its metallic or non-metallic properties. For example, elements on the left side of the periodic table tend to be metals, while those on the right side are non-metals. This systematic arrangement allows for predictions about an element's behavior and characteristics based on its position in the table.
